Controversy Surrounding Lionel Messi’s Debut with Inter Miami

Englishman David Beckham, one of the co-owners of Inter Miami, has caused controversy with his claims that Argentine star Lionel Messi’s debut with the American team could be postponed.

Lionel Messi has decided to join Inter Miami as a free transfer after his contract with France’s Paris Saint-Germain expires this summer, and he was due to play against Mexican side Cruz Azul this week.

But David Beckham, in a statement to ESPN Argentina, said: “We do not know if Leo will play the match or not, he must be ready before returning to the matches again.”

He added, “We have to protect him and make sure he’s ready because he was on vacation and just arrived in Miami and looks to be in good shape, but the decision is ultimately up to him and coach Tata Martino.”

Notably, tickets for Inter Miami’s game against Mexican team Cruz Azul have already been sold at very high prices, as fans wait for Messi to make his first appearance in the American team’s jersey.
